软件开发进度管理制度_第1页
软件开发进度管理制度_第2页
软件开发进度管理制度_第3页
软件开发进度管理制度_第4页
软件开发进度管理制度_第5页
已阅读5页,还剩3页未读 继续免费阅读

下载本文档

版权说明:本文档由用户提供并上传,收益归属内容提供方,若内容存在侵权,请进行举报或认领

文档简介

软件开发进度管理制度一、总则(一)目的为了规范公司软件开发项目的进度管理,确保项目按时交付,提高项目的成功率,特制定本制度。(二)适用范围本制度适用于公司内所有软件开发项目,包括自主研发项目、外包项目以及合作项目等。(三)原则1.计划性原则:项目启动前应制定详细的项目计划,明确各阶段的任务、时间节点和责任人。2.监控性原则:建立有效的监控机制,对项目进度进行实时跟踪和评估,及时发现问题并采取措施解决。3.沟通协调原则:加强项目团队内部及与相关部门之间的沟通协调,确保信息畅通,协同推进项目进度。4.灵活性原则:根据项目实际情况,在确保项目目标的前提下,合理调整计划,应对各种变化。二、项目计划制定(一)项目启动阶段1.项目立项:由业务部门提出软件开发项目需求,经公司管理层审批通过后立项。2.组建项目团队:根据项目需求,确定项目经理、开发人员、测试人员、质量保证人员等组成项目团队。3.项目初步评估:项目经理组织项目团队对项目进行初步评估,包括技术难度、工作量、时间周期等,为制定项目计划提供依据。(二)项目计划制定1.制定项目总体计划:项目经理根据项目初步评估结果,制定项目总体计划,包括项目目标、阶段划分、里程碑、任务分解、时间安排、资源需求等。2.任务分解:将项目总体任务分解为具体的子任务,明确每个子任务的负责人、开始时间、结束时间和交付成果。3.资源分配:根据任务分解结果,合理分配人力资源、硬件资源、软件资源等,确保项目顺利进行。4.计划评审:项目总体计划制定完成后,组织相关部门和人员进行评审,对计划的合理性、可行性进行评估,提出修改意见,经修改完善后确定最终的项目计划。(三)项目计划发布1.计划发布:项目计划确定后,由项目经理发布给项目团队成员、相关部门和利益相关者,确保各方了解项目计划和各自的职责。2.计划沟通:项目经理组织项目团队成员进行计划沟通,确保每个成员都清楚自己的任务和时间要求,明确项目的整体目标和进度安排。三、项目进度监控(一)监控频率1.项目周会:项目团队每周召开一次项目周会,汇报项目进展情况,讨论解决项目中遇到的问题。2.项目日报:项目团队成员每天填写项目日报,汇报当天的工作进展、遇到的问题及解决方案。3.项目进度跟踪表:项目经理定期更新项目进度跟踪表,直观展示项目进度情况,及时发现偏差。(二)监控内容1.任务完成情况:检查各子任务的实际完成情况是否与计划一致,是否按时交付成果。2.资源使用情况:监控人力资源、硬件资源、软件资源等的使用情况,是否存在资源闲置或不足的情况。3.问题解决情况:跟踪项目中出现的问题是否得到及时解决,解决措施是否有效。4.风险情况:评估项目面临的风险是否发生变化,是否需要采取新的风险应对措施。(三)偏差分析与处理1.偏差识别:通过对比项目实际进度与计划进度,识别出进度偏差。2.偏差分析:分析偏差产生的原因,包括任务难度估计不准确、资源不足、人员变动、外部因素影响等。3.偏差处理:根据偏差分析结果,采取相应的处理措施,如调整计划、增加资源、优化任务安排、协调外部关系等,确保项目进度回到正轨。四、项目进度调整(一)调整原因1.需求变更:项目实施过程中,客户或业务部门提出需求变更,导致项目计划需要调整。2.技术难题:遇到技术难题,原计划的技术方案无法实现,需要调整计划。3.资源变动:人力资源、硬件资源、软件资源等发生变动,影响项目进度,需要调整计划。4.外部因素:政策法规变化、市场竞争等外部因素影响项目进度,需要调整计划。(二)调整流程1.变更申请:由提出变更的部门或人员填写变更申请表,说明变更的原因、内容和对项目进度的影响。2.变更评估:项目经理组织相关人员对变更申请进行评估,分析变更的必要性、可行性和对项目的影响程度。3.变更审批:变更评估通过后,提交公司管理层进行审批,审批通过后实施变更。4.计划调整:根据变更审批结果,项目经理对项目计划进行调整,重新发布项目计划,并组织项目团队成员进行沟通和培训。五、项目进度考核(一)考核指标1.项目按时交付率:考核项目是否按时完成交付,计算公式为:按时交付项目数/项目总数×100%。2.里程碑达成率:考核项目各里程碑是否按时达成,计算公式为:按时达成里程碑数/里程碑总数×100%。3.任务完成率:考核项目各子任务的完成情况,计算公式为:实际完成任务数/任务总数×100%。(二)考核周期1.月度考核:每月对项目进度进行一次月度考核,统计项目的各项考核指标完成情况。2.季度考核:每季度对项目进度进行一次季度考核,对月度考核结果进行汇总和分析,评估项目整体进度情况。3.年度考核:每年对项目进度进行一次年度考核,对全年的项目进度情况进行全面总结和评价。(三)考核结果应用1.绩效奖金:根据项目进度考核结果,发放项目团队成员的绩效奖金,对按时完成项目的团队给予奖励,对进度滞后的团队进行相应的处罚。2.晋升调薪:将项目进度考核结果作为员工晋升调薪的重要依据之一,对在项目中表现优秀、按时完成项目的员工给予优先晋升和调薪机会。3.项目总结:在项目结束后,对项目进度管理情况进行总结,分析经验教训,为今后的项目管理提供参考。六、沟通与协调(一)内部沟通1.项目团队沟通:项目团队成员之间应保持密切沟通,及时分享工作进展、问题及解决方案,确保项目信息畅通。2.跨部门沟通:涉及多个部门的项目,应加强跨部门沟通协调,明确各部门的职责和工作接口,避免出现沟通不畅、工作推诿等问题。3.定期沟通会议:定期召开项目沟通会议,如项目周会、月会等,汇报项目进展情况,讨论解决项目中遇到的问题,协调各方资源。(二)外部沟通1.客户沟通:与客户保持密切沟通,及时了解客户需求和意见,反馈项目进展情况,确保项目成果符合客户要求。2.合作伙伴沟通:与合作伙伴保持良好的沟通协调,共同推进项目实施,及时解决合作中出现的问题。3.行业交流:关注行业动态,参加行业交流活动,学习借鉴先进的软件开发项目管理经验,提升公司项目管理水平。七、风险管理(一)风险识别1.技术风险:评估项目可能面临的技术难题,如技术选型不当、技术方案不可行等。2.人员风险:考虑项目团队成员的技术能力、工作经验、人员稳定性等因素,识别可能对项目进度产生影响的人员风险。3.需求风险:分析项目需求的明确性、稳定性,识别需求变更可能带来的风险。4.资源风险:评估项目所需的人力资源、硬件资源、软件资源等的供应情况,识别资源短缺或不足可能导致的风险。5.外部风险:关注政策法规变化、市场竞争、自然灾害等外部因素对项目进度的影响。(二)风险评估1.可能性评估:评估风险发生的可能性大小,分为高、中、低三个等级。2.影响程度评估:评估风险发生后对项目进度、质量、成本等方面的影响程度,分为严重、较大、一般三个等级。3.风险矩阵:根据可能性评估和影响程度评估结果,建立风险矩阵,确定风险的优先级。(三)风险应对1.风险规避:对于高风险且无法有效应对的风险,采取风险规避措施,如取消项目或调整项目方案。2.风险减轻:对于中风险,采取风险减轻措施,如加强技术研发、增加人员培训、优化需求管理等,降低风险发生的可能性或减轻风险的影响程度。3.风险转移:对于某些风险,可以通过购买保险、签订合同等方式将风险转移给第三方。4.风险接受:对于低风险,在采取一定的防范措施后,可以接受风险,同时密切关注风险的变化情况。八、文档管理(一)项目文档分类1.项目计划文档:包括项目总体计划、项目进度跟踪表、项目日报等。2.需求文档:包括需求规格说明书、用户需求文档等。3.设计文档:包括软件架构设计文档、数据库设计文档等。4.开发文档:包括代码注释、开发日志等。5.测试文档:包括测试计划、测试用例、测试报告等。6.项目总结文档:包括项目总结报告、经验教训总结等。(二)文档编写要求1.准确性:文档内容应准确反映项目实际情况,避免出现错误或歧义。2.完整性:文档应涵盖项目的各个方面,确保信息完整。3.规范性:文档编写应遵循公司统一的文档规范和格式要求。4.及时性:文档应及时编写和更新,确保与项目进度同步。(三)文档管理流程1.文档创建:项目团队成员根据各自的职责,负责相关文档的创建和编写。2.文档审核:文档编写完成后,提交给项目经理进行审

温馨提示

  • 1. 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。图纸软件为CAD,CAXA,PROE,UG,SolidWorks等.压缩文件请下载最新的WinRAR软件解压。
  • 2. 本站的文档不包含任何第三方提供的附件图纸等,如果需要附件,请联系上传者。文件的所有权益归上传用户所有。
  • 3. 本站RAR压缩包中若带图纸,网页内容里面会有图纸预览,若没有图纸预览就没有图纸。
  • 4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
  • 5. 人人文库网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对用户上传分享的文档内容本身不做任何修改或编辑,并不能对任何下载内容负责。
  • 6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
  • 7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。

评论

0/150

提交评论